About Elan Credit Card APK

Elan Credit Card is a mobile account-management app for cardmembers whose financial institution partners with Elan Financial Services. After signing in, users can review balances, available credit, pending and posted transactions, and recent spending without visiting a desktop site. The app also supports one-time payments, AutoPay management, transaction and due-date alerts, and real-time card locking when a card is misplaced. Quick actions, biometric sign-in on supported devices, and the interactive Money Tracker help cardholders handle routine account tasks and understand where their money goes.

Features & use cases

Balances, Transactions, and Money Tracker

Elan Credit Card places balances, available credit, and recent activity in one mobile account view. Cardholders can review pending and posted transactions, then search for a specific charge by date or amount when they need to reconcile a purchase. The current Money Tracker adds another way to understand spending by grouping activity around categories, merchants, or selected timeframes.

This combination supports both quick daily checks and closer monthly reviews. A user can confirm how much credit remains, distinguish a pending charge from a completed one, and explore patterns without assembling records by hand. For people who manage an Elan-issued card regularly, the app turns scattered account details into a practical spending dashboard.

One-Time Payments and AutoPay Control

Payments are designed around regular card-account tasks rather than a separate banking workflow. After signing in, cardholders can make a one-time payment, choose a date and amount, or set up AutoPay for repeating obligations. Pending payments can also be reviewed, which helps users see whether an instruction is waiting to process before they submit another one.

The payment tools are especially useful near a due date or after a large purchase. Users can pair the account balance and available-credit view with the payment screen, check the details, and decide between a single transfer and an automatic schedule. Keeping those actions in the same app reduces trips to a desktop account site while preserving a clear confirmation step for important financial instructions.

Card Locking, Alerts, and Account Protection

Card controls give users a fast response when a physical card is misplaced or account activity needs attention. The real-time lock and unlock option can limit access without immediately closing the account, while transaction alerts help cardholders monitor activity. Due-date alerts and notices about personal-information changes add reminders around events that are easy to miss.

These controls work best as part of a routine: review a notification, inspect the related transaction, then lock the card or contact support if something looks wrong. Cardholders can choose how alerts are delivered and use biometric sign-in on supported devices for quicker return access. The result is a set of practical account safeguards that remain close to balances, payments, and recent activity.

Quick Actions for Everyday Card Management

Quick-action menus make common account tasks easier to reach from a phone. After cardmember sign-in, users can move from the account overview to recent transactions, payment tools, alerts, rewards, and card controls without navigating a full desktop site. The app is designed for Elan cardholders whose financial institution uses Elan Financial Services for credit card servicing.

That focus makes the app useful for short, recurring sessions: checking a charge while shopping, confirming available credit before a purchase, reviewing spending by merchant, or handling a payment away from a computer. It also keeps related information together, so a cardholder can move from a balance question to the relevant transaction or payment action with less searching. Quick actions and focused navigation make the mobile account useful between statements.
